The points (-3, 1), (-1, 1), (0, -1),(-1, -3), (-3, -3), and (-4, -1) are vertices of a polygon. What type of polygon is formed by these points?

Respuesta :

MrSmoot MrSmoot
  • 04-04-2019

Answer:

a hexagon

Step-by-step explanation:

There are 6 points, which makes for 6 vertices.  There are as many sides to a polygon as there are vertices, the polygon is a hexagon
